要使用PhpSpreadsheet库导入数据,首先确保已经安装了该库
composer require phpoffice/phpspreadsheet
接下来,按照以下步骤操作:
require 'vendor/autoload.php';
use PhpOffice\PhpSpreadsheet\IOFactory;
$inputFileName = 'path/to/your/excel/file.xlsx';
$spreadsheet = IOFactory::load($inputFileName);
$worksheet = $spreadsheet->getActiveSheet();
$cellRange = 'A1:D10';
$data = $worksheet->rangeToArray($cellRange, null, true, true, false);
$data
变量现在包含了一个二维数组,其中每个子数组表示一行数据,每个子数组的元素表示相应列的值。例如:
Array
(
[0] => Array
(
[0] => John
[1] => Doe
[2] => 30
[3] => United States
)
[1] => Array
(
[0] => Jane
[1] => Smith
[2] => 28
[3] => United Kingdom
)
// ... 更多行数据
)
现在你可以对这些数据进行进一步处理,例如将其保存到数据库或导出到其他格式。